Police investigate cult activities in Kira

KIRA, Wakiso District — Police in Kira Division have launched investigations into a suspected murder following the discovery of a decomposing body believed to be that of a missing woman.

The deceased has been identified as Naziwa Oliver, 52, a resident of Kito ‘A’ in Kirinya, Kira Municipality.

According to Luke Owoyesigyire, the case was initially reported on April 28, 2026, after relatives raised concern over her disappearance, which dates back to October 2025.

On May 4, police conducted a search at a suspect’s residence, where the body was discovered in a locked room alongside clothing identified as belonging to the deceased.

Two suspects, including Nanyonjo Rose—a biological relative of the deceased—have since been arrested to assist with investigations.

The scene was processed, statements recorded, and the remains transported to the city mortuary for postmortem examination.

Preliminary findings indicate that the suspects may have been operating a cult-like group that discouraged members from seeking medical treatment and conducting proper burials.

Police have warned the public against engaging in illegal cult activities, noting that such practices pose serious risks to life. Investigations into the matter are ongoing.
